Context for plugin authors: every retry of a charge call must reuse the original key. Keys are scoped per merchant, expire after 48h. The gateway now rejects mismatched payloads under the same key with a 409 — don't swallow that error. Vexa finished the dedup store migration; remaining work is documenting the backoff contract and updating the sample plugin. Test fixtures are in the Larchmont sandbox. Full key-format spec and retry semantics are documented on the internal page below.

wiki page, tahaf-tajog: https://jira.ordindyn.corp/pipeline

Ticket #4417 — Driftwell ingest worker leaks fds. lsof shows pipe handles climbing ~40/hr under sustained load. Suspect the retry path in the archive unpacker skips close() on short reads. Repro: loop malformed archives for 10 min. Review the attached diff for the early-return fix. Leak reproduced and confirmed fixed on the build identified by the token below.

trace token, hahof-haduf: htk31_a20ec8af49c8eef513a19b91f9b9b72

## Data-Centre Cage Visits (Harlow Point Site)

New starters visiting the Quillbrook cage must be accompanied by a cleared escort at all times. Sign in at the site office, leave phones in the lockers provided, and wear your visitor lanyard visibly. The cage door uses a keypad rather than badge readers, so escorts should memorise rather than write down the entry sequence. The current cage access code is shown below.

turnstile pass: bdg-FVNQRS-72965873

## Session Handling — Snapshot Testing (Bramblehook UI)

Snapshot runs open one authenticated session per suite so rendered components include real session-derived props. Do not commit regenerated snapshots without reviewing diffs. Stale sessions cause spurious avatar and locale mismatches; restart the runner if you see them. To start a local snapshot session against staging, use the token below.

session JWT of yawep-yawep = eyJhbGciOiJIUzI1NiIsInR5cCI6IkpXVCJ9.eyJzdWIiOiI3pWF3_In0.aXYsHiog